Evidence-based medicine under attack | Public Library of Science
www.plos.org
Here we go again. Evidence-based medicine (EBM) has once more come under fire, only this time the accusations are even more brutal. The EBM movement, says a group of academics at the University of Ottawa and the University of Toronto, is "outrageously exclusionary," "dangerously normative," and "a good example of microfascism at play." As an EBM believer, I guess this would make me a microfascist.
